A bit stuck on how to do this

Answers

Answer:

x = 40°

Step-by-step explanation:

Two sides are the same length, so the angles opposite them are the same size.

The sum of the angles = 180°. One angle is 100°, so the sum of the remaining two angles is 80°.

Since the remaining two angles are congruent, each is 40°.

What is a function?

A function is a relation from a set of inputs to a set of possible outputs where each input is related to exactly one output.
